One question that many people make is how you can make backup copies of programs that already has one installed. It is logical: if we have many software installed and we want to format the computer, we lose everything and we will have to reinstall one by one from scratch with the installation disk.
The most typical mistake made by the person who wants to avoid this problem is to copy the folder of a program, or even some who gets to copy the icon of the desktop. But that is no use at all for backing up the programs. In this article we are going to show you what you should do.
How to back up installed programs
One of the possible solutions to save a backup of programs (printers, scanners, all free software downloaded from the Internet, etc.) is given by Windows itself, if we have a PC. We must create a system image . What is an image of the system? Very easy:
"It's an exact copy of your PC, which includes everything there is at the moment. Programs, files and folders and operating system. With it you can restore your PC to the state it was in before. "
The advantages of making an image of the system are several. One of them is that you can move your programs and files to a new computer without having to start all over 0. The other is that you can save your files if you enter a virus begins to damage the system files and you need to restore your system .
It has different names and forms of access depending on the operating system you use ( XP, Vista, Windows 7 or 8 ), but neither has much loss. The process for doing it in Windows is as follows:
- 1. Windows XP: enter My Computer, click on the right mouse button on the C: drive and give it to "Properties". Then go to Tools> Backup Now. We follow the steps of the wizard and make a copy of the files and the configuration.
- 2. Windows Vista and Windows 7: enter the Control Panel> System and Security> Backup and Restore. Click on the option in the left panel to "create a system image".
- 3. Windows 8: enter Settings> Control Panel> Create a system image.
In any case we have to specify which units you want to include and where is saved copy of the system image with all files and programs, which can be an external hard drive , but can also be internal (not the same system), in several DVDor a path FTP to host it in the cloud.
